    Cartesian coordinates are a system of locating points on a graph using two perpendicular lines, typically labeled as the x-axis and y-axis. Each point on the graph has a unique pair of coordinates, which are represented by the distance from the point to each axis. Understanding how to read and create graphs using Cartesian coordinates is a fundamental skill that can be applied to various fields.
